<title>Capitan restaurant owner runs for Congress (New Mexico)</title>
<link>http://www.freerepublic.com/focus/f-gop/1923134/posts</link>
<description>A rancher and restaurant owner from Capitan plans to seek the Republican nomination from New Mexico&#x26;#x92;s 2nd Congressional District. Ed Tinsley said he will make his formal announcement Nov. 19 for the district. The incumbent, Republican Steve Pearce, will not seek re-election so he can run for the U.S. Senate. Six-term Republican Sen. Pete Domenici will retire in January 2009 because of an incurable brain disease. Tinsley is a former chairman of the National Restaurant Association and current owner of the K-Bob&#x26;#x92;s steakhouse brand. <title>New Mexico: &#x26;#x91;Land of disenchantment&#x26;#x27; (race to succeed Steve Pearce)

</title>
<link>http://www.freerepublic.com/focus/f-gop/1917688/posts</link>
<description>New Mexico Rep. Steve Pearce&#x26;#x92;s decision to run for the seat of retiring Sen. Pete V. Domenici (R-N.M.) opens up yet another House seat that both parties plan on aggressively contesting. Pearce is the 13th House Republican not to run for reelection this cycle. Ten have announced their retirement, while three have opted to run for higher office. The district, spanning rural southern New Mexico, is solidly Republican. It gave President Bush 57 percent of the vote in 2004. &#x26;#x93;This is a Republican stronghold.
